- Can I use puff pastry?
- This is a cookie dough, not a pastry. Puff pastry would make it a completely different dessert (flakier, less crunchy).
- Storage?
- Airtight container. They stay crunchy for a week.
- Nuts?
- Almonds are traditional ("Mandel"), but pearl sugar alone is also common in Sweden.
Scandinavian Cinnamon Sticks with Almond Crunch
A hybrid between a shortbread cookie and a sweet bread, this recipe utilizes a higher fat-to-flour ratio to create a tender crumb. Unlike yeast-based cinnamon rolls, these are chemically leavened, resulting in a denser, snappier texture. The topping provides the essential textural contrast: the sugar caramelizes while the almonds toast directly on the dough.

Equipment Needed
- Pizza Cutter: The best tool for cutting the dough strips cleanly without dragging.
- Pastry Brush: For applying the milk wash evenly.

Instructions
1
✓
Blend dry ingredients. Cut in cold butter to create a sandy texture with visible fat pockets.
Tip: Using a 'frisage' technique (smearing butter bits with the heel of your hand) creates flaky layers similar to puff pastry.
2
✓
Combine wet ingredients and incorporate into the flour mix. Work quickly to form a soft dough.
Tip: The dough will be stickier than bread dough. Do not over-flour the surface, or the sticks will become dry and hard.
3
✓
Flatten to 1/2-inch thickness, slice into batons. Brush with milk and apply toppings heavily.
Tip: Use a rolling pizza cutter for clean edges. Ragged edges (from a dull knife) seal the dough and inhibit rising.
4
✓
Bake at 350°F (180°C) for 12-15 minutes.
Tip: Remove from the oven while the centers are still soft to the touch; residual heat will finish the baking process on the cooling rack.

Ingredients
- 4 cups All-Purpose Flour
- 0.5 cup Granulated Sugar
- 1 tbsp Baking Powder
- 0.5 tsp Salt
- 2 sticks Unsalted Butter (cold, cubed)
- 1 large Egg
- 1.25 cups Whole Milk
- 1 tbsp Ground Cinnamon
- 0.5 cup Almonds (chopped)
- 2 tbsp Milk (for brushing)
- 1 tbsp Coarse Sugar (for sprinkling)
